Detecting multiple chargers coupled to the same battery

1. A controller of a communications network, the controller comprising:
a processor operable to create a monitoring set of battery chargers by placing a set of battery chargers in a monitoring mode;
wherein the processor is further operable to perform multiple iterations of a multiple-charging source (MCS) detection process;
wherein each of the multiple iterations of the MCS detection process comprises:
creating an active one of the monitoring set of battery chargers by placing one of the monitoring set of battery chargers in an active state in which the active one of the monitoring set of battery chargers attempts to charge any battery to which the active one of the monitoring set of battery chargers is connected; and
logging an error event based at least in part on at least one of the monitoring set of battery chargers detecting charging activity on any battery to which the monitoring set of battery chargers is connected.
